On Monday, 29 July, an explosion occurred at BASF, Germany’s largest chemical plant. This was reported by "Komersant Ukrainian" with reference to the a press releasepublished by the concern.

The explosion escalated into a fire, which was quickly contained and extinguished. Fourteen workers were slightly injured.

The city authorities and the fire service have issued a hazard warning as the fire could release harmful substances into the air. The fire service is asking people to avoid the affected areas, keep windows and doors closed, and switch off ventilation and air conditioning systems.

It should be noted that BASF Societas Europaea is a German chemical company headquartered in Ludwigshafen, Rhineland-Palatinate. BASF is the world’s largest chemical company and produces a wide range of products: plastics, paints, cosmetics, food additives, technical and construction chemicals, and agrochemical plant protection products.
